## Flagwright Rollouts — Quick Ops Notes

If a staged rollout on Flagwright stalls at a percentage bucket, it's almost always the cohort hasher, not the flag itself. Check the `bucketer` pod logs first; a stuck rollout usually means Flagwright can't reach the Cohortia segment service. You can kick the sync manually with `flagwright sync --force`, but do it once, not in a loop, or you'll thundering-herd Cohortia. The sync call authenticates against Cohortia with a service key, pasted here for convenience.

gateway credential: kto3_qfe

Handover Note — Joint Venture Proposal

For the board: I am transferring oversight of the proposed joint venture with Ardenfell Materials to Director Mireille Voss, effective next week. Due diligence on their Calvermouth plant is complete; legal review of the shareholding split is underway. Outstanding items are the governance charter and the capital schedule, both expected within a fortnight. Mireille will present the full recommendation at the next board session. The confidential planning note follows below.

internal memo for kawip-hadug: Headcount on the Wenwyn team goes from 7 to 140 by the end of January. Gross margin on Wenwyn came in at 20 percent against a plan of 15 percent.

Handover for the Harrowfield telemetry gateway: the ingest service polls tractor units every 30 seconds and buffers to disk when the uplink drops. Watch the buffer-depth metric; anything over 10k records means the uplink is flapping. Restart order matters — broker first, then gateway. Full restart steps are on the internal page.

dashboard of bafof-hafog = https://confluence.lumiclabs.internal/display/browse/display/6a09a20a

### Step 4: Enable batched resolvers

The Fernwick API now batches nested lookups via the new loader layer, eliminating the N+1 pattern on order queries. Deploy the resolver service before the gateway, then flip the loader flag. Batch size and cache TTLs must match across replicas. Apply the configuration values below to every node.

settings of tagef-bawif:
DRUIX_HOST=druix.zemvarlabs.internal
DRUIX_PORT=8000